The Perfect Sequel
What do you all want for a potential Dragon Commander 2?
Personally, I want more options, more choices, more Role-Play opportunities and characters.
I want more policies, more representatives arguing, character creation options (race, dragon type, gender, and for each to mean something in role-play)... perhaps tons of scenes and random events that are described in written form to keep workload and costs down, while still providing more of everything regarding being, A Prince/Princess, a Dragon, The Emperor/Empress, and the topmost leader of the military in the middle of a war... also peacetime, I want peacetime, and declaring war. To me, Dragon Commander isn't a strategy game, it's a Role-Playing game about being An Emperor, which just to happens to mean war, combat, conquest. It would be incomplete without it.

Also more brides, of equal or greater quality to the ones we currently have.
Though I don't really want the brides to be the most interesting thing in the game... I want running/ruling the empire to be the most interesting thing, with your wife being a considerable facet of that.

Though... I am torn on whether or not my perfect Dragon Commander 2 would continue with parodying real world politics, or would be mostly fantasy politics?

With modern politics being what they are... I kinda don't want Larian to do modern real world politics again, as that would most likely just make everybody angry, whether they take a side or try to be neutral and accurate to both... probably better to go to made-up fantasy politics.
